This book is a remarkable collage of interesting (and sometimes horrifying) stories of hardships and heroism of captains wives and children on board ship during the Nineteenth Century. Drawing on first-person accounts from journals and letters, the book provides an insight into life on board from a different point of view. . Hard Cover. As New/Very Good.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
